Sewer Lateral Installation in Columbus, OH
Sewer lateral installation involves connecting a property's main sewer line to the municipal sewer system, typically extending from the building's foundation to the property line or street. This service covers new construction projects, replacements of aging or damaged sewer lines, and upgrades to improve flow and prevent backups.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ing persistent drainage issues, planning a property renovation, or purchasing a home that requires a sewer line connection or upgrade.
Before requesting sewer lateral installation, property owners should understand the scope of the project, including the location of existing utilities, property boundaries,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also helpful to know the condition of the current sewer line, whether a replacement or new installation is needed, and any potential obstacles such as tree roots or underground obstructions.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the property.

Sewer Lateral Installation Questions
What is sewer lateral installation? It involves installing or replacing the pipe that connects a property’s plumbing system to the main sewer line.
When is sewer lateral installation needed? It is typically required during new construction, property upgrades, or when existing pipes are damaged or blocked.
What types of pipes are used for sewer lateral installation? Common options include PVC, ABS, or cast iron pipes, chosen based on property needs and local codes.
How does the installation process work? It involves excavating the area, removing old or damaged pipes, and installing new pipes to ensure proper flow to the sewer system.
